Python学习
千里之外z
人生几何?
展开
-
python版本切换
sudoupdate-alternatives --install/usr/bin/pythonpython/usr/bin/python2100sudoupdate-alternatives --install/usr/bin/pythonpython/usr/bin/python3150原创 2020-02-17 15:30:36 · 202 阅读 · 0 评论 -
Python学习
1.ASCII(1个字节) ->Unicode(多语言的出现 改为两个字节)->UTF-8(考虑存储资源 多数字符为英文 改为多字节表示 类似可变长编码 在最新的Python 3版本中,字符串是以Unicode编码) # -*- coding: utf-8 -*-告诉Python解释器,按照UTF-8编码读取源代码,否则,你在源代码中写的中文输出可能会有乱码申明了UT...原创 2018-02-26 10:52:38 · 227 阅读 · 0 评论 -
python 处理IP所属地
先安装这两个pip install python-geoip-geolite2 -i https://pypi.douban.com/simplepip install geoip2然后下载资源搜一搜GeoLite2-Country.mmdb第一个链接就有测试代码import geoip2.database#GeoLite2-City.mmdb文件的位置read...转载 2018-08-16 15:26:30 · 1133 阅读 · 0 评论 -
Python 常用
1.数组中是固定的字典 按字典中的元素值排序例如:# 信息按照状态逆序 生成时间逆序排序data_sort = sorted(data, key=lambda e: (-1 * e.__getitem__('is_finish'), e.__getitem__('commit_time')), reverse=True)...原创 2019-09-01 11:25:15 · 99 阅读 · 0 评论